Output e82891e13838998fc499c30c13e19295a74aa0c8f60495779c85b949d7c602ea:7

value
26893
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1885343ad88b08cb94c2cd8b5619d47f985abaaa OP_EQUALVERIFY OP_CHECKSIG
address
13EennLdNDxJ87xWcjjh82NXoAXRvEogLr
transaction
e82891e13838998fc499c30c13e19295a74aa0c8f60495779c85b949d7c602ea
spent
true